Walk among ancient columns where the first Olympic Games began in 776 BCE at the Archaeological Site of Olympia. Visit the Archaeological Museum to see the impressive Hermes of Praxiteles statue and artefacts from Western Greece's most important sanctuary.

Best time to go to Archaia Olympia

The best time to visit Archaia Olympia is dependant on what kind of holiday you are seeking. August is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is sunny with no rain.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ly low and weather is mostly sunny with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January47.3°F (8.5°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owSlightly Low
February48.7°F (9.3°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
March51.8°F (11.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
April57.9°F (14.4°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
May65.3°F (18.5°C)No RainSunnyAverageAverage
June73.2°F (22.9°C)No RainSunnyAverageSlightly High
July79.7°F (26.5°C)No RainSunnySlightly HighSlightly High
August80.2°F (26.8°C)No RainSunnySlightly HighSlightly High
September73.0°F (22.8°C)Light RainSunnyAverageAverage
October65.1°F (18.4°C)Light RainSunnyAverageAverage
November57.9°F (14.4°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owSlightly Low
December50.4°F (10.2°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owAverage

The nearest major airports for your trip to Archaia Olympia

Flying into Archaia Olympia is convenient with three major airports nearby. Zakynthos International Airport (ZTH) is approximately 66.0km away, offering luxurious accommodation options such as the 5-star Hotel Contessina, 8.0km from the airport, and the Meandros Boutique & Spa Hotel, just 1.6km away. Kalamata International Airport (KLX) is situated 75.6km from Archaia Olympia, with excellent hotels like the Elysian Luxury Hotel & Spa, 6.4km away. Meanwhile, Araxos Airport (GPA) lies 59.5km from Archaia Olympia, with options such as the Grecotel Casa Marron, 6.4km from the airport. What's the weather like in Archaia Olympia?
The hottest months are usually August and July, with an average temperature of 25°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 10°C. Average annual precipitation for Archaia Olympia is 907 mm.
